Farmingdale Man Dies as Result of Canoe Incident

Augusta, Maine - A 43-year-old man died this evening, the result of a capsized canoe incident this afternoon (Sunday, Sept 6, 2009) on Damariscotta Lake in Jefferson.

Kenneth J. Soucy, 43, of Farmingdale and his son, Alex Soucy, 23, of Jefferson both went into approximately 7 feet of water, about 30-40 feet from shore, when the canoe they were in capsized at approximately 2:15 p.m. this afternoon.

Mr. Kenneth Soucy went under the water and did not come up, according to Game Warden Doug Kulis. A neighbor on shore, Mr. Terry Beal, saw the incident, went into the water and pulled Mr. Kenneth Soucy above the water and to shore. Mr. Alex Soucy was able to swim to shore.

Mr. Kenneth Soucy was transported to Miles Memorial Hospital in Damariscotta, where he died this evening.

Life jackets were in the canoe.

The incident is under investigation.
